33rd Annual ALGIM Conference
The 33rd Annual ALGIM Conference was held from 17 - 20 November 2013 at the Bayview Wairakei Resort, State Highway One, Taupo, New Zealand.
This year’s conference combined ALGIM’s key areas and acquainted delegates with numerous exhibitor stands, best practice local government case studies, workshops, overseas experiences, networking opportunities, international and national speakers, and a prestigious national awards programme.
The event also showcased leading local government case studies - both nationally and internationally. This year the programme focused on ‘Working Together, Working Smarter through Shared Services, Mobility and Cloud’.

2013 Annual ALGIM Awards
The use of technology in our organisations is continually expanding. There are many innovative solutions being designed and implemented which are worth sharing for the benefit of the local government ICT sector as a whole.
The Annual ALGIM Awards recognise and celebrate best practice within local government information technology and information management. They aim to encourage local authorities to be innovative and to exercise technological leadership through services to its community. The awards also promote the image of local government ICT throughout the wider community.

The awards were presented to the winners at the 2013 Annual ALGIM Conference Formal Conference Awards Dinner on Tuesday 19 November 2013 at the Bayview Wairakei Resort, Taupo.
Congratulations to the following winners:
2013 ALGIM Best Project Award
Sponsored by | Intergen
Winner: Auckland Council, Programme iSmart
Runner up: Thames-Coromandel District Council, Online Building Consent Portal
2013 ALGIM Excellence in Innovation Award
Sponsored by | ManageEngine
Winner: Taupo District Council, Delivering Fully Automated LIM's - A Collaboration with Technology Approach
Runner up: New Plymouth District Council, Community Directories
2013 ALGIM Collaboration Award
Sponsored by | Information Leadership
Winner: Waikato Regional Council, Regional Council Collaborative Development Group, IRIS Development Project
Runner Up: Horowhenua District Council, Te Takere - Our Journey to find the Treasures in our Waka of Knowledge
2013 ALGIM Supreme Award
Sponsored by | Leapthought
Winner: Horowhenua District Council, Te Takere - Our Journey to find the Treasures in our Waka of Knowledge
ALGIM Excellence in Leadership Award
Sponsored by | Leapthought
Winner: Eion Hall, Hamilton City Council
